Chhath Stampede in Patna: 18 Dead, Many Injured

TNI Bureau: Tragedy struck Bihar’s capital Patna this evening during the Chhath puja, as at least 18 people have been killed in the stampede at Ganga Ghat. The death toll could up further. Many people are said to be injured.

The stampede occurred during the Chhath puja. Thousands of people had gathered to worship Sun god as part of the rituals. The stampede was attributed to the collapse of a temorary bamboo bridge.

The injured have been rushed to the hospitals. Many are still missing. The agitated people have blamed the adminstration for the poor arrangements. The police have cordoned off the area.
